Output 58f596bbc3363bb0d66d4442e534796c995b22623f76850e6f8b1b79c761c1f1:0

value
156260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22e59d95c5e58f563fc0b274b7ad5ccabb87d9a4 OP_EQUAL
address
34sXy2zpuDgy2v1LvnQG3MsuPNj4TnSkAA
transaction
58f596bbc3363bb0d66d4442e534796c995b22623f76850e6f8b1b79c761c1f1
spent
true